3920.  WIETZEL, G., STARKE, A., AND EISENHUT, O. (I. G. Farbenindustrie A. G.). [Carbon Monoxide And Hydrogen From Hydrocarbons.] German Patent 488,502, Apr. 16, 1926. Chem. Abs., vol. 24, 1930, p. 2.251.

Gaseous hydrocarbons or gas mixtures containing them are partly oxidized or electrically treated to form, in part, unsaturated hydrocarbons; these may be removed and the remaining gas made to react with H2O vapor or O2 or both to form mixtures of CO and H2 for synthesis of MeOH and higher alcohols, or the CO may be oxidized to CO2 and removed, leaving only H2.
